Marquette vs Valparaiso: TV Channel, Start Time, and Betting Odds

In an exciting mid-major matchup, the Marquette Golden Eagles will host the Valparaiso Beacons. This game is pivotal for both teams as they navigate their early-season schedules. Marquette, with a current record of 4-4, is looking to secure a victory after a close loss to Oklahoma. The game is scheduled for Tuesday, December 2, at 7 p.m. CT, taking place at Fiserv Forum.

Game Details: Marquette vs Valparaiso

  • Date: December 2
  • Time: 7 p.m. CT
  • Location: Fiserv Forum, Milwaukee

This game marks the last time Marquette will face a mid-major opponent this season. Following this matchup, they will take on high-profile teams, including a visit to Wisconsin and a road game against the top-ranked Purdue Boilermakers.

Viewing Options

The game will not be broadcast on traditional television. However, fans can watch via streaming on ESPN+, requiring a subscription. For those interested in radio coverage, the game will air on:

  • ESPN Milwaukee WKTI FM-94.5
  • WCUB 980 AM (Two Rivers)
  • WDLB 1450 AM (Marshfield)
  • WSCO 95.3 FM/1570 AM (Appleton)
  • WSCO 99.1 FM (Oshkosh)

Steve “Homer” True will provide play-by-play commentary, accompanied by analyst Tony Smith. Additionally, listeners can tune into the Marquette broadcast on SiriusXM Radio, channel 390 and through the SiriusXM app.

Betting Odds

According to BetMGM, the betting odds for the game as of December 2 are:

  • Spread: Marquette by 17.5 points
  • Over/Under: 147.5 points
  • Moneyline: Marquette -2000, Valparaiso +950

Senior guard Chase Ross is a standout player for Marquette, leading the Big East with an impressive average of 20.9 points per game. He has consistently scored in double figures throughout the season, making him a key player to watch in this crucial matchup.
